Что дальше с Shell?

Shell – это удобный и мощный командный интерпретатор, который используется в операционных системах UNIX и Linux для взаимодействия с пользователем и управления различными задачами. С развитием технологий и появлением новых требований, Shell продолжает развиваться и адаптироваться под изменяющиеся условия.

Одним из главных направлений развития Shell является автоматизация рутинных задач. С помощью Shell-скриптов можно автоматизировать множество процессов и упростить повседневную работу разработчиков и системных администраторов. Это позволяет сократить время выполнения задач, снизить вероятность ошибок и повысить эффективность работы. Благодаря своей гибкости и возможности интеграции с другими инструментами, Shell остается незаменимым инструментом в области автоматизации задач.

Еще одной перспективой развития Shell является его интеграция с облачными сервисами и инфраструктурой. С развитием облачных технологий все больше компаний переходят на облачные платформы для разработки и развертывания своих приложений. Shell позволяет управлять облачными ресурсами, создавать и конфигурировать виртуальные машины, автоматизировать процессы масштабирования и управления облачными сервисами. В этой связи, разработчики Shell активно работают над развитием инструментов и библиотек, которые упрощают взаимодействие с облачными платформами и делают его более удобным и эффективным.

Таким образом, Shell остается актуальным и востребованным инструментом в сфере разработки и системного администрирования. Его развитие и будущее связано с автоматизацией задач и интеграцией с облачными сервисами. С появлением новых технологий и требований, Shell будет продолжать адаптироваться и расширять свои возможности, чтобы упростить и усовершенствовать рабочий процесс разработчиков и администраторов.

Перспективы развития оболочки Shell в операционных системах

Оболочка Shell – основной интерфейс командной строки в операционных системах, который позволяет пользователю взаимодействовать с компьютером при помощи команд. В настоящее время разрабатываются различные оболочки, каждая из которых имеет свои особенности и преимущества.

Автоматизация задач

Одним из основных направлений развития оболочки Shell является улучшение возможностей автоматизации задач. С помощью скриптов и командных файлов, написанных на языке оболочки, можно автоматизировать выполнение рутинных задач, упростить их выполнение и снизить вероятность ошибок.

Поддержка новых функций

С развитием технологий и появлением новых возможностей в операционных системах, оболочки Shell должны постоянно обновляться и поддерживать эти функции. Например, в современных оболочках добавляются возможности многозадачности, работы с сетью, поддержки новых файловых систем и т.д.

Улучшение интерфейса

Одним из основных направлений развития оболочки Shell является улучшение ее интерфейса. Это включает в себя улучшение подсветки синтаксиса, автодополнения, работы с историей команд и других возможностей, которые делают использование оболочки более удобным и эффективным.

Улучшение безопасности

В современных оболочках Shell уделяется большое внимание вопросам безопасности. Разработчики стараются устранить уязвимости, связанные с выполнением команд извне, предотвратить возможность выполнения вредоносного кода и обеспечить защиту от несанкционированного доступа.

Расширение возможностей

Некоторые оболочки, такие как Bash, имеют возможность расширения своих функций с помощью плагинов и дополнительных инструментов. Это позволяет пользователям настраивать оболочку под свои нужды, добавлять новые команды и функциональность, что делает использование оболочки более гибким.

Развитие оболочки Shell является важным аспектом развития операционных систем. Оно позволяет упростить взаимодействие пользователей с компьютером, повысить эффективность и безопасность работы, а также добавить новые функции и возможности.

Популярность Shell и его влияние на разработку программного обеспечения

Shell является одним из самых популярных и универсальных интерфейсов командной строки, который используется для взаимодействия с операционной системой. Благодаря своей простоте и мощности, он нашел широкое применение в различных областях, связанных с программированием и управлением компьютерными ресурсами.

Одной из главных причин популярности Shell является его возможность автоматизации рутины и повышения эффективности работы разработчика. С помощью команд Shell можно создавать скрипты, которые выполняют определенные задачи автоматически, что значительно ускоряет процесс разработки программного обеспечения.

Shell также предоставляет программистам мощные инструменты для управления файлами и каталогами. Благодаря командам Shell можно выполнять операции поиска, фильтрации, переименования и перемещения файлов с легкостью. Более того, Shell позволяет выполнять эти операции на множестве файлов одновременно, что делает его незаменимым инструментом для разработчиков и системных администраторов.

Shell имеет большое влияние на разработку программного обеспечения, так как многие современные языки программирования поддерживают выполнение команд Shell внутри своего кода. Это позволяет разработчикам использовать силу командной строки в своих программах, делая их более гибкими и мощными.

Кроме того, многие операционные системы предоставляют пользовательский интерфейс командной строки, основанный на Shell. Это позволяет пользователям выполнять различные задачи с помощью команд Shell, даже если они не являются опытными программистами. Таким образом, Shell становится доступным для широкой аудитории пользователей, увеличивая его влияние на разработку программного обеспечения.

В целом, популярность Shell и его влияние на разработку программного обеспечения трудно переоценить. Благодаря своей простоте, мощности и универсальности, Shell остается одним из основных инструментов в арсенале разработчиков и системных администраторов.

Инновации и функциональные возможности Shell: от скриптинга до облачных сервисов

Shell – это командная оболочка операционной системы, которая позволяет пользователю взаимодействовать с компьютером через команды. С течением времени Shell стала развиваться и претерпевать изменения, приобретая новые инновационные возможности. В данной статье рассмотрим несколько важных новшеств и функциональных возможностей Shell, включая скриптинг и облачные сервисы.

Скриптинг

Одной из важных возможностей Shell является возможность написания скриптов, которые позволяют автоматизировать различные задачи. Скрипты позволяют пользователю выполнять группы команд последовательно или условно, что значительно упрощает и ускоряет работу с операционной системой.

Shell поддерживает различные языки программирования для написания скриптов, включая Bash, PowerShell и другие. Пользователь может выбрать подходящий язык и использовать его для создания скриптов, соответствующих своим потребностям.

Многоязычная поддержка

Современные версии Shell поддерживают работу с разными языками программирования и кодировками. Это позволяет пользователю удобно работать с текстовыми файлами и скриптами, написанными на разных языках.

Благодаря многоязычной поддержке, Shell становится более универсальным инструментом, позволяющим работать с различными типами данных и файлами.

Облачные сервисы

С развитием облачных технологий, Shell также приспосабливается к новым требованиям и интегрируется с облачными сервисами. Это позволяет пользователям работать с облачными хранилищами данных, виртуальными серверами и другими облачными сервисами через командную строку.

Интеграция Shell и облачных сервисов предоставляет пользователям гибкость и возможность управлять своими данными и ресурсами в облаке, используя привычный интерфейс командной строки.

Дополнительные функции

Помимо вышеупомянутых возможностей, Shell предлагает и другие инновации и функциональные возможности. Некоторые из них включают:

  • Встроенные команды и утилиты для управления файлами и папками, сетевыми настройками, системными ресурсами и т. д.
  • Возможность перенаправления вывода команды на файл или другую команду.
  • Режимы работы, такие как интерактивный режим, пакетный режим и другие.
  • Возможность создания алиасов и функций для упрощения работы с командами.
  • Возможности работы с пайпами (|), позволяющие комбинировать и перенаправлять вывод команд.
  • Поддержка переменных, условий и циклов.

Все эти возможности делают Shell универсальным инструментом для автоматизации задач, управления системой и работой с данными.

Вывод

Shell продолжает развиваться и приспосабливаться к новым требованиям и технологиям. Инновации и функциональные возможности Shell, включая скриптинг и интеграцию с облачными сервисами, делают его мощным инструментом для работы с операционной системой и автоматизации задач.

Shell и автоматизация бизнес-процессов: перспективы и потенциал

Shell-скрипты — это мощное средство автоматизации бизнес-процессов. Они позволяют выполнить любые повторяющиеся задачи, освобождая время и ресурсы компании для более важных задач.

Ниже приведены некоторые преимущества использования Shell-скриптов для автоматизации бизнес-процессов:

  • Эффективность: Shell-скрипты позволяют автоматизировать длительные и сложные процессы. Они могут выполняться быстро и точно, что снижает риск ошибок и улучшает общую эффективность.
  • Гибкость: Shell-скрипты могут быть адаптированы под конкретные бизнес-процессы, что позволяет им выполнять широкий спектр задач. Они могут быть использованы для обработки данных, автоматической генерации отчетов, резервного копирования и многого другого.
  • Легкость использования: Shell-скрипты доступны даже для тех пользователей, которые не имеют глубоких знаний программирования. Они имеют простой синтаксис и понятную структуру, что делает их доступными для широкого круга сотрудников.

Применение Shell-скриптов для автоматизации бизнес-процессов имеет большой потенциал. Они могут значительно упростить и ускорить выполнение задач и позволить компании сфокусироваться на своих основных целях и задачах.

Одним из примеров применения Shell-скриптов для автоматизации бизнес-процессов является регулярное резервное копирование данных. С помощью Shell-скрипта можно настроить автоматическое создание резервной копии данных компании и перенести эту задачу на автоматический режим работы, что позволит сотрудникам сосредоточиться на более важных задачах.

Также, Shell-скрипты могут быть использованы для автоматической генерации отчетов, мониторинга системы, обновления ПО и многих других задач.

Пример автоматизации процесса резервного копирования данных с помощью Shell-скрипта
Шаг Описание
Шаг 1 Подготовить необходимые файлы и директории для резервного копирования
Шаг 2 Написать Shell-скрипт, который будет выполнять операции копирования и сохранения данных на сервере
Шаг 3 Настроить расписание выполнения Shell-скрипта с помощью cron или другого планировщика задач
Шаг 4 Проверить результаты и установить уведомления об успешном или неуспешном выполнении задачи

Shell-скрипты имеют большой потенциал в автоматизации бизнес-процессов. Они позволяют сотрудникам компании сосредоточиться на более важных задачах и улучшить производительность компании в целом.

Будущее Shell: мобильные устройства, интернет вещей, искусственный интеллект

Shell, один из самых популярных командных интерпретаторов в Unix-подобных операционных системах, имеет большое будущее в сфере мобильных устройств, интернета вещей и искусственного интеллекта. Развитие этих технологий открывает новые возможности для использования Shell и делает его незаменимым инструментом для управления и автоматизации различных задач.

Мобильные устройства становятся все более распространенными и мощными, и Shell может стать идеальным инструментом для управления этими устройствами. С помощью Shell можно легко управлять файлами, устанавливать и запускать приложения, настраивать настройки системы и выполнять другие необходимые операции. Благодаря Shell пользователи могут получить полный контроль над своими мобильными устройствами и повысить уровень производительности и безопасности.

Интернет вещей — это сеть взаимодействующих устройств, способных обмениваться данными и выполнять определенные действия без прямого участия человека. Shell может стать важной частью этой сети, предоставляя возможность удаленного управления устройствами и интеграцию различных систем. С помощью Shell можно создавать скрипты для автоматического управления устройствами, обрабатывать полученные данные и принимать решения на основе анализа этих данных. Это позволяет повысить эффективность работы сети, упростить управление устройствами и сократить затраты на их обслуживание.

Искусственный интеллект играет все более важную роль в различных сферах жизни, и Shell может стать важным инструментом для работы с искусственным интеллектом. Shell позволяет выполнять вычисления, обрабатывать данные и принимать решения на основе определенных правил и моделей. С помощью Shell можно создавать и управлять скриптами, которые обеспечивают взаимодействие между различными компонентами искусственного интеллекта и обрабатывают полученные результаты. Это помогает интегрировать искусственный интеллект в различные системы и повышает его эффективность и применимость.

В целом, будущее Shell связано с развитием мобильных устройств, интернета вещей и искусственного интеллекта. Shell становится все более важным инструментом для управления и автоматизации различных задач, что позволяет повысить эффективность и безопасность работы с устройствами и системами. Развитие Shell в этих направлениях открывает новые возможности для его применения и делает его незаменимым инструментом для разработчиков и администраторов систем.

Вопрос-ответ

Какие перспективы развития у компании Shell?

Компания Shell имеет многообещающие перспективы развития. Она активно вкладывает средства в исследования и разработки новых технологий, особенно в области восстановления и использования природных ресурсов. Shell также инвестирует в развитие программ устойчивого развития, таких как производство и использование возобновляемых источников энергии. Компания также стремится к сокращению выбросов вредных веществ и уменьшению экологического следа своей деятельности. В целом, Shell продолжает искать новые рынки и возможности развития, чтобы оставаться одним из лидеров в энергетической отрасли.

Какую роль может сыграть Shell в переходе на возобновляемые источники энергии?

Shell признает важность перехода на возобновляемые источники энергии и активно инвестирует в разработку и производство таких источников. В частности, компания сосредоточена на развитии ветроэнергетики, солнечной энергетики и биотоплива. Shell также внедряет новые технологии, такие как хранение энергии и улучшение энергоэффективности. Компания также работает над развитием инфраструктуры для зарядки электромобилей и развитием технологий энергетического хранения. Shell является одним из ключевых игроков в переходе к возобновляемым источникам энергии.

Какие вызовы и препятствия могут стоять на пути развития Shell?

Хотя у Shell есть многообещающие перспективы, компания также сталкивается с некоторыми вызовами и препятствиями. Одним из них является увеличение конкуренции в энергетической отрасли, особенно со стороны новых игроков в сфере возобновляемых источников энергии. Еще одним вызовом может стать изменение геополитической обстановки, что может повлиять на доступ к ресурсам и рынкам для компании. Кроме того, изменение в энергетической политике и требования по сокращению выбросов может потребовать дополнительных инвестиций и адаптации со стороны Shell. Все эти факторы могут влиять на будущее развитие компании.

Оцените статью
kompter.ru
Добавить комментарий